TIBCO unveiled a series of products and services that target service performance management, and that leverage the insights that managed complex events processing [CEP] provides. These complex events processing and service performance management find common ground -- to help provide a new level of insurance against failure for SOA and for enterprise IT architects.
They deal with organizations like Allstate, which have massive size and scale, with 750 services. People are moving away from the older ways of doing things -- from the siloed applications, the siloed business unit way of doing things -- to the SOA, services-based way of doing things, you don’t ignore the new complexities you are introducing.
SOA is helping the companies reuse services. They are making services available, so that that functionality, that code, doesn’t need to be rewritten time and time again. In doing so the company reduces the amount of work, the cost of building new applications, of building new functionality for a business organization.
